Spock's Story
Located in North Bethesda, Maryland.<br/><br/>Meet Spock, a handsome Maine Coon mix who came to the rescue as an owner surrender. Spock is a friendly, outgoing cat who absolutely loves people and thrives on human companionship. Once he settles in, he’s incredibly affectionate, enjoys being close to his humans, and is even a bit of a lap cat!<br/><br/>Spock is a social and vocal boy with a big personality — and one adorable quirk is that he wags his tail like a dog. He loves pets, attention, and simply being around his people. He may take a little time to warm up in a new environment, but once comfortable, he becomes very friendly and devoted. He enjoys sleeping in, getting brushed, and hanging out nearby soaking up affection. While he’s not a fan of being picked up or having his nails trimmed, he happily accepts love on his own terms.<br/><br/>This playful boy does best with larger, confident male cats who can match his rough-and-tumble play style. He got along very well with an older male cat and also did great with dogs. However, he can be too intense for smaller or timid cats, especially female littermates, as he may chase, corner, or taunt them during play. Because of this, we recommend a home with either no other cats or only confident, assertive male cats who can handle his energetic personality.<br/><br/>Spock can sometimes get overexcited during playtime and may accidentally scratch, so he would do best with adopters who understand cat behavior and can help redirect rough play appropriately.<br/><br/>If you’re looking for a fluffy, talkative companion with lots of personality who loves affection and being near his people, Spock may be your perfect match!
